Designated Brokerage Services (DBS) provides brokerage solutions for corporate clients who monitor their employees’ securities trading activity. DBS offers an employee trade monitoring solution via the trade-rules technology for financial service firms who choose to allow their employees to maintain brokerage accounts outside of their own firm.  Firms can supervise employee trading subject to FINRA Rule 3210, and Investment Advisors Act of 1940 Rules 17j-1 and 204A-1.  In addition, DBS provides Rule 3210 status information to corporate clients and internal Schwab departments, and they respond to corporate client inquiries.

The DBS Operations Associate is responsible for processing client-initiated service requests that are received via email.  These requests are primarily requests to link and/or delink specific employee Schwab accounts that are associated with the firm’s Master Account(s).  In addition, the Associate will have the knowledge to assist with researching transaction or holding inquiries, data feeds, and other duties as assigned.
